Vietnam may become shareholder of Eurasian Development Bank

(VOVworld) – Twelve countries are candidates for membership of the Eurasian Development Bank (EADB) by the end of 2017, Dmitriy Pankin, Chairman of the bank’s Management Board said on Wednesday.

In his statement, Pankin said the bank hopes to obtain the relevant licence to increase of the number of the participants in the EADB financial system by the end of next year and to complete all formal procedures by early 2018.

Vietnam is one among 12 candidates including Azerbaijan, Egypt, Israel, India, Indonesia, Iran, Mongolia, Singapore, Thailand, South Korea, and Japan.

He said factors including commercial relations and investment activities with members of the Eurasia Economic Union have been taken into account while selecting the candidates.

Vietnam and Iran have completed all the required technical steps.
